Yankees Squelch Cubs Offense in Shutout Win
Chicago pitcher Teddy Higuera gave the Yankees all they could handle, but in the end, New York left Wrigley Field with a 3-0 win. Higuera allowed 3 earned runs on 3 hits over 9 innings. Brian Bohanon got the win, improving to 10-8. He pitched 7 innings, giving up 6 hits and no runs, while striking out 4 and walking 2. German Jimenez converted his 11th save in 20 tries.

New York used the bat of Andy Stankiewicz to get the win. The second baseman hammered a 2-run home run in the top of the fifth inning to put the Yankees ahead, 3-0. It was his lone hit in 3 at-bats, but it did its damage.

"We put some tough at-bats on some tough pitches," said New York manager Patrick McQuail.

New York occupies 5th place in the Federal League East Division at 46-74.
